Transaction 28fce2ee2007340c40c2ca1055ea64eaf0976577a999bc39e664603d1baba445

3 Input
2 Outputs
  • 28fce2ee2007340c40c2ca1055ea64eaf0976577a999bc39e664603d1baba445:0
  • value  11193149
    address  3HzFAKJpVWmoEQTP2kfKKvV6mivVMpUZgJ
  • 28fce2ee2007340c40c2ca1055ea64eaf0976577a999bc39e664603d1baba445:1
  • value  30392105
    address  171hhs4Yq7v94xHc2vfRjxasbj1uYzCGSe